Concussion symptoms: Can vary very widely despite the severity of impact. Any concussion that includes a loss of consciousness requires a closer evaluation and probably a more indepth work up. If you are symptom free and have been cleared by your physician it is permissible to attempt a graded return to play over the course of a week or so.
